    Apple of My Eye
    • 1 1/2 oz Apple Brandy
    • 1 oz Bourbon or Rye
    • 3/4 oz Apple Spiced Demerara Syrup
    • 1/4 oz Lemon Juice
    • 3/4 oz Unsweetened Cranberry Juice
    • Shake all ingredients with ice until well-chilled. Double strain into a coupe glass. Garnish with a dash of cinnamon.

    It's Just Lemonade ... Surprise!
    • 2 oz Gin
    • 1 1/2 oz - 2 oz Lemon juice syrup (50/50 lemon juice and water)
    • 1 dash Lemon bitters (optional)
    • 4-6 oz Club soda
    • Add gin and lemon juice syrup, and lemon bitters to a highball glass and stir to combine. Fill the glass with ice and top with club soda. Garnish with floating brandied cherries and lemon wedge if desired.

    Matthew's Simplified Old Fashioned
    • 2 oz bourbon
    • ¾ oz demerara gum syrup
    • 2 dashes Angostura bitters
    • Orange peel (for garnish)
    • Luxardo cherry (for garnish)
    • Combine bourbon, demerara gum syrup, and bitters in a mixing glass with ice and stir until well-chilled. Strain into a rocks glass over a large ice cube. Express the oil from an orange peel over the drink. Garnish with the orange peel and a Luxardo cherry.

    Gin & Ginger Beer
    • 2 oz London dry gin
    • 3-4 oz Ginger beer
    • 7 Brandied cherries for garnish
    • Add gin a four cherries to an empty high ball glass. Fill glass with ice. Top with ginger beer and remaining cherries.

    Negroni
    • 1 1/2 oz London dry gin
    • 1 1/2 oz Sweet vermouth
    • 1 1/2 oz Campari
    • Orange twist for garnish
    • Combine the gin, vermouth and Campari in a mixing glass with ice and stir to desired dilution. Strain the cocktail into a rocks glass and carefully add a single large chunk of ice. Express the orange twist over the glass and drop into the glass. Then trick your brother into a bet where he has to drink it.

    The Fitzgerald
    • 2 oz gin
    • 1 oz lemon juice
    • 1 oz simple syrup
    • 2 dashes Angostura bitters
    • 2 dashes Peychaud's bitters (Matthew's stamp)
    • Combine all ingredients in shaker with ice. Shake 10-12 seconds. Double strain into a coupe glass.
